Craig Bradford Associates is Hiring a Purchaser Near King of Prussia, PA

Comp : $50K-$60K

Job Summary

We are seeking a detail-oriented individual (full time) to serve as a Purchaser to handle all purchasing responsibilities generated by the various foreman, project managers, service, and water management team.

As a key member of the construction and service team, the successful candidate will be responsible for purchase order generation, substitutions, replacements, tracking, delivery times, inventory control and authorization of payment for goods and services.

The ideal candidate will have the ability to multi-task in a fast-paced environment and possess solid computer skills in Excel.

Familiarity with commonly used pool building construction and service materials, components, equipment, and supplies is preferred.

Responsibilities

Ordering all equipment and materials for construction jobs

Schedule all orders for timely delivery

Track all orders

Communicate all order issues to the construction team.

Maintain and update order logs.

Manages and coordinates all RGA’s and follow up for vendor credits.

Works with ERP program Sage to set up new vendors and subcontractors.

Monitor and reorder stock inventory.

Skills and Qualifications

Previous purchasing / ordering experience (Construction or pool industry a plus)

Experience using Sage 100, QuickBooks, or other ERP programs.

Ability to communicate effectively orally, in writing, in person and by phone.

Proficient skill with Microsoft applications (Word, Excel, and Outlook)

Ability to work independently under pressure and react quickly to changing priorities.
